feat: surface macros as first-class custom commands in the REPL
Implements the invocation and management surfaces from plans/custom-commands-design.md §4 and §6: - Top-level dispatch: an enabled macro <name> now runs as ".<name> [args]" from the command catch-all; runtime-disabled macros point at ".macro enable <name>", locked macros name the owning config, and unknown commands keep the existing error verbatim - .macro enable|disable <name>: runtime toggles over the in-memory global-level enabled_macros list (disable with no list materializes all-active-minus-name); toggles error when a role/agent/session allowlist owns the field - .set enabled_macros <csv|null> with workspace-then-global existence validation; .set key completion gains enabled_macros and the previously missing enabled_skills - Dynamic completion: enabled macros (with descriptions) join built-ins on ".<TAB>" without touching the static command registry; ".macro <TAB>" lists invocable macros (incl. built-in-shadowed ones) plus the enable/disable subcommands; second-arg completion offers toggle-eligible names - .list macros: enriched table (name, source, isolated, state, description) covering every resolver state incl. missing and shadowed rows; .help gains a custom-commands section - Session info/render and sysinfo display enabled_macros; Macro::load resolves workspace-then-global; enable/disable rejected as macro names in the creator
